在当今数字化时代,APP开发已成为企业和个人实现商业目标的重要手段。随着技术的不断进步和市场需求的日益增长,越来越多的公司开始涉足这一领域,提供各种类型的APP开发制作平台。以下是一些知名的APP开发制作平台:
一、AppGenius
1. 特点:AppGenius是一个为开发者提供一站式服务的云开发平台,它允许用户快速创建和发布移动应用程序。该平台提供了丰富的模板和组件,使非技术人员也能轻松开发出功能丰富的应用。
2. 优点:AppGenius的优势在于其用户友好的界面和丰富的资源库。它提供了大量的设计模板和组件,帮助开发者节省时间和精力,提高开发效率。
3. 缺点:虽然AppGenius提供了许多便利的功能,但它的价格相对较高,可能不适合预算有限的小型企业或个人开发者。
二、Tango
1. 特点:Tango是一款专为安卓开发者设计的IDE,它提供了一个直观的用户界面和强大的代码编辑功能。Tango支持多种编程语言,包括Java、Kotlin和JavaScript,使得开发者可以跨平台进行开发。
2. 优点:Tango的最大优点是它的跨平台能力。开发者可以使用同一套代码库在不同操作系统上开发应用,极大地提高了开发效率和灵活性。
3. 缺点:Tango的学习和使用成本较高,需要一定的编程基础才能充分发挥其潜力。同时,由于其强大的功能,对于某些简单的项目来说可能显得过于复杂。
三、Xamarin Studio
1. 特点:Xamarin是一家专注于跨平台开发的公司,其推出的Xamarin Studio是一个集成开发环境,支持多种编程语言和框架。它可以帮助开发者快速构建高质量的原生应用和Web应用。
2. 优点:Xamarin Studio的优点在于其强大的跨平台支持。它可以让开发者在同一套代码库的基础上,开发出适用于不同操作系统和设备的应用程序。这使得开发过程更加高效,降低了维护成本。
3. 缺点:Xamarin Studio的学习曲线较陡,需要开发者具备一定的编程经验和技术背景。同时,由于其强大的功能,对于某些简单的项目来说可能显得过于复杂。
四、PhoneGap
1. 特点:PhoneGap是一个开源的项目,允许开发人员使用HTML、CSS和JavaScript等Web技术来开发跨平台的移动应用。它提供了丰富的API和插件,使得开发者可以轻松地将Web应用转换为移动应用。
2. 优点:PhoneGap的最大优点是其跨平台能力。它可以让开发者用一套代码库开发出适用于iOS、Android和WP等多个平台的应用程序。这使得开发过程更加高效,降低了维护成本。
3. 缺点:PhoneGap的缺点在于其依赖外部插件和API,这可能导致应用的稳定性和性能受到影响。同时,由于其跨平台的特点,对于某些复杂的项目来说可能显得不够灵活。
综上所述,这些APP开发制作平台各有特色和优势,但也存在各自的不足之处。在选择适合自己的平台时,开发者应充分考虑自己的需求、项目规模以及预算等因素,以做出最合适的决策。